this model is farking garbage. it has issues handshaking with other usb-c chargers correctly which makes it take FOREVER to charge sometimes. like there is zero reason a 10k power bank should take 10 hours to charge when plugged into a 90W MBP charger using a thunderbolt cable. multiple fast chargers and cables, same result. lots of reviews complaining about the same issue.

the 10,000mah model with the built in usb-c cord does not have this issue for whatever reason.

Quote from aralk :
Probably you've fried the internals by using 90W charger. Use up to 30W chargers at the most to charge the battery pack. Lots of laptops get fried too. Usually on the USB-C ports. Some people are using overly powerful chargers and plug it in the wrong port.
No doubt people fry things by plugging cords into wrong ports, but the 90watt charger itself wouldn't really do anything. The receiving port is going to take whatever charge watts it wants, regardless even if the charger was 200 watts. The only problem from a charger is if somehow you plug a wrong charger in and supplying a wrong voltage. Poof!
